If you are determined to have an original I can completely understand and respect that. I'm not afraid to spend the kind of $$$ the original 550's command ... but I can't justify it like I did with my AUG A2.

Long before SiG came out with the 556 and knowing the 89 ban would never be repealed, I dreamed SiG would build a compliant 55x rifle; one that would take AR mags ... rock-in mags are (and should be) a thing of the past.

Needless to say, I was pleased and pissed when SiG came out with the 556 ... pleased that they did it but pissed that they ignored the buying public and outfitted them with cheap-ass furniture. I didn't let that stop me since furniture can be changed and the overall cost was just a fraction of the cost compared to an original. Now of course they are offering their rifles with original furniture, and still 1/5th the cost of a preban.

The SIG 556 has had some teething issues. I don't remember the threads but over at the SIG forum there is some issue with the semi bolt or bolt carrier chipping off IIRC.

Even so I too would like one of these rifles... without that cheese grater forend.
 
The SIG 556 has had some teething issues. I don't remember the threads but over at the SIG forum there is some issue with the semi bolt or bolt carrier chipping off IIRC.

Yeah, a bottom edge along the bolt carrier was getting pinged on something as it rode back and forth. It was an iisue with some Sig 556s within a certain set of serial no's.
I think this issue has been addressed; atleast my 556 has not been affected by this.

As for the "funiture" issue; while true that there are better sights available than what is on the gun, the ones Sig provides are perfectly adequate as far as diopter/iron sights.
The red dot one found on some is OK but nothing better than BSA or Tasco make, and certainly no where near Eotac. But, like the flat top M4orgery line, there is a world of stuff out there in sights and scopes that will work very well on the Sig 556.
